<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">header.bg-dark h1,
header.bg-dark h2,
header.bg-dark h3,
header.bg-dark h4,
header.bg-dark h5,
header.bg-dark h6,
header.bg-dark p {
  color: #fff;
}

.nav-current {
  color: #fff;
}
ul ul .nav-current {
  background: #ddd;
  color: #212529;
}
.nav-active {
  color: rgba(255, 255, 255, 0.75);
}

a.link-light.small.metanav-current {
  color: #ff8700 !important;
}

.rootline a, .rootline a:visited {
  color: #666;
  display: inline-block;
}
.rootline a:hover {
  color: #000;
}
.rootline a:after {
  display: inline-block;
  content: "&gt;";
  margin: 0 .5rem;
}

.ce-gallery img {display: unset;}
.ce-intext [data-ce-columns="1"],
.ce-intext [data-ce-columns="2"],
.ce-intext [data-ce-columns="3"],
.ce-intext [data-ce-columns="4"] {
  width: 100%;
}

.ce-intext [data-ce-columns="2"] .ce-column,
.ce-center [data-ce-columns="2"] .ce-column {
  width: 48%;
  margin-right: 2%;
}

.ce-intext [data-ce-columns="3"] .ce-column,
.ce-center [data-ce-columns="3"] .ce-column {
  width: 31%;
  margin-right: 2%;
}

.ce-intext [data-ce-columns="4"] .ce-column,
.ce-center [data-ce-columns="4"] .ce-column {
  width: 23%;
  margin-right: 2%;
}

.ce-intext.ce-right .ce-gallery {
  margin-left: 0;
}

.ce-intext.ce-left .ce-gallery {
  margin-right: 0;
}

.ce-textpic,
.ce-image,
.ce-nowrap .ce-bodytext,
.ce-uploads li,
.ce-uploads div {
  overflow: visible;
}
@media screen and (min-width: 601px) {
  .ce-intext [data-ce-columns="1"],
  .ce-intext [data-ce-columns="2"],
  .ce-intext [data-ce-columns="3"],
  .ce-intext [data-ce-columns="4"] {
    width: 50%;
  }
  .ce-intext.ce-right .ce-gallery {
    margin-left: 1rem;
  }
  .ce-intext.ce-left .ce-gallery {
    margin-right: 1rem;
  }
  .ce-textpic,
  .ce-image,
  .ce-nowrap .ce-bodytext,
  .ce-uploads li,
  .ce-uploads div {
    overflow: hidden;
  }
}


.ce-gallery figure.video {
  display: block;
}


/* Responsive Videos mit Fluid Styled Content */
.video-embed {
  position: relative;
  padding-bottom: 56.25%;
  height: 0;
  overflow: hidden;
  margin-bottom: 1.5rem;
}

.video-embed iframe,
.video-embed video {
  position: absolute;
  top: 0;
  left: 0;
  max-width: 100%;
  width: 100% !important;
  height: 100% !important;
}

.ce-center:has(.video-embed) .ce-inner {
  position: relative;
  float: none;
  right: -50%;
}

.ce-left:has(.video-embed) .ce-gallery,
.ce-column:has(.video-embed) {
  float: none;
}

.ce-center:has(.video-embed) .ce-outer {
  position: relative;
  float: none;
  right: 50%;
}


/* indexed_search */
.navbar .tx-indexedsearch-searchbox form {
  margin-top: 3px;
}
@media screen and (min-width:992px){
  .navbar .tx-indexedsearch-searchbox form {
    margin-left: 20px;
  }
}
.navbar .tx-indexedsearch-searchbox form input,
.navbar .tx-indexedsearch-searchbox form input.btn {
  font-size: .8rem;
}

/* Sprachmenüe */
li.languageitem a,
li.languageitem a:visited {
  color: #ccc;
}
li.languageitem .activetranslation {
  color: #fff;
}
li.languageitem .notranslation {
  color: #666;
}
.testdeployment {
  color: #ff0000;
}

/* indexed search */
.tx-indexedsearch-browsebox {
  margin: 1rem 0;
}
.tx-indexedsearch-browsebox,
.tx-indexedsearch-browsebox li {
  list-style-type: none;
  padding: 0;
  margin: 0;
}
.tx-indexedsearch-browsebox {
  margin: 1rem 0;
}
.tx-indexedsearch-browsebox li {
  display: inline-block;
  margin: 0 .5rem 0 0;
}
.tx-indexedsearch-browsebox li a,
.tx-indexedsearch-browsebox li a:visited {
  color: #666;
  display: inline-block;
  border: 1px solid #222;
  padding: .2rem .4rem;
  text-decoration: none;
}
.tx-indexedsearch-browsebox li a:hover,
.tx-indexedsearch-browsebox li a:focus {
  background: #aeceff;
  color: #222;
}

.tabpanel-button:not(.collapsed) {
    color: var(--bs-tabpanel-active-color);
    background-color: var(--bs-tabpanel-active-bg);
    box-shadow: inset 0 calc(-1*var(--bs-tabpanel-border-width)) 0 var(--bs-tabpanel-border-color)
}

.tabpanel-button:not(.collapsed)::after {
    background-image: var(--bs-tabpanel-btn-active-icon);
    transform: var(--bs-tabpanel-btn-icon-transform)
}

.tabpanel-button::after {
    flex-shrink: 0;
    width: var(--bs-tabpanel-btn-icon-width);
    height: var(--bs-tabpanel-btn-icon-width);
    margin-left: auto;
    content: "";
    background-image: var(--bs-tabpanel-btn-icon);
    background-repeat: no-repeat;
    background-size: var(--bs-tabpanel-btn-icon-width);
    transition: var(--bs-tabpanel-btn-icon-transition)
}

@media (prefers-reduced-motion:reduce) {
    .tabpanel-button::after {
        transition: none
    }
}

.tabpanel-button:hover {
    z-index: 2
}

.tabpanel-button:focus {
    z-index: 3;
    border-color: var(--bs-tabpanel-btn-focus-border-color);
    outline: 0;
    box-shadow: var(--bs-tabpanel-btn-focus-box-shadow)
}

.tabpanel-header,.frame-type-menu_abstract ul ul,.frame-type-menu_categorized_content ul ul,.frame-type-menu_pages ul ul,.frame-type-menu_recently_updated ul ul,.frame-type-menu_related_pages ul ul,.frame-type-menu_section ul ul,.frame-type-menu_section_pages ul ul,.frame-type-menu_sitemap ul ul,.frame-type-menu_sitemap_pages ul ul,.frame-type-menu_subpages ul ul {
    margin-bottom: 0
}

.tabpanel-item {
    color: var(--bs-tabpanel-color);
    background-color: var(--bs-tabpanel-bg);
    border: var(--bs-tabpanel-border-width) solid var(--bs-tabpanel-border-color)
}

.tabpanel-item:first-of-type {
    border-top-left-radius: var(--bs-tabpanel-border-radius);
    border-top-right-radius: var(--bs-tabpanel-border-radius)
}

.tabpanel-item:first-of-type .tabpanel-button {
    border-top-left-radius: var(--bs-tabpanel-inner-border-radius);
    border-top-right-radius: var(--bs-tabpanel-inner-border-radius)
}

.tabpanel-item:not(:first-of-type) {
    border-top: 0
}

.tabpanel-item:last-of-type,.tabpanel-item:last-of-type .tabpanel-collapse {
    border-bottom-right-radius: var(--bs-tabpanel-border-radius);
    border-bottom-left-radius: var(--bs-tabpanel-border-radius)
}

.tabpanel-item:last-of-type .tabpanel-button.collapsed {
    border-bottom-right-radius: var(--bs-tabpanel-inner-border-radius);
    border-bottom-left-radius: var(--bs-tabpanel-inner-border-radius)
}

.tabpanel-body {
    padding: var(--bs-tabpanel-body-padding-y) var(--bs-tabpanel-body-padding-x)
}

.tabpanel-flush .tabpanel-collapse {
    border-width: 0
}

.tabpanel-flush .tabpanel-item {
    border-right: 0;
    border-left: 0;
    border-radius: 0
}

.tabpanel-flush .tabpanel-item:first-child {
    border-top: 0
}

.tabpanel-flush .tabpanel-item:last-child {
    border-bottom: 0
}

.tabpanel-flush .tabpanel-item .tabpanel-button,.tabpanel-flush .tabpanel-item .tabpanel-button.collapsed {
    border-radius: 0
}


/*
.frame-layout-10 {
  --bs-bg-opacity: 1;
    background-color: rgba(var(--bs-primary-rgb),var(--bs-bg-opacity))!important;
    color:#ccc
}
*/
</pre></body></html>